Mexican Singer Ana Gabriel To Celebrate 50-Year Career With Arena Tour

Ana Gabriel performs at Coliseo Jose M. Agrelot on Sept. 27, 2014, in San Juan, Puerto Rico. (Photo by GV Cruz/WireImage)

To celebrate her 50th year in the music industry, Ana Gabriel announced “Un Deseo Más Tour 2024,” a 24-city trek promoted by Cárdenas Marketing Network that will have the Mexican singer visiting notable arenas throughout North America this fall, including the soon-to-open Intuit Dome in Inglewood, California.

Gabriel, who is known as the “Moon of America,” shared the news on social media, asking fans to join her on “this adventure of 50, yes, 50, and thus, to be able to embrace them again with her music, that is my wish and my greatest desire. And it will be forever”. She has already successfully taken the “Un Deseo Más Tour,” which translates to “One More Wish,” to Mexico and is ready to celebrate her legacy as one of Latin America’s most iconic voices with the U.S. and Canada. She will begin the North American leg of the tour at Prudential Center in Newark, New Jersey, on Sept. 13 and make stops at Brooklyn’s Barclays Center, Chicago’s Allstate Arena, Texas Trust CU Theatre in Dallas, Seattle’s Wamu Theater, Amalie Arena in Tampa, Toronto’s Coca-Cola Coliseum and Montreal’s Place Bell. The run comes to a close at Kaseya Center in Miami, Florida, on Nov. 30.

“For us at CMN, counting and producing the tours of an iconic artist like Ana Gabriel will always be a source of pride, her dedication and commitment to her fans commit us as a production company in each tour to execute shows of great height and quality,” Henry Cárdenas, CEO of CMN, said in a statement.

The presale window for tickets opens May 9 at 10 a.m. local time followed by the general onsale, which begins May 10 at 10 a.m. local time.

Gabriel’s “Por Amor A Ustedes World Tour” was a hit in 2023, grossing nearly $34 million off 35 headline reports submitted to the Pollstar Boxoffice. One of her most successful showings was sold-out two nights at Inglewood’s Kia Forum on Feb. 25 and 26 which earned her $3,052,480 off 24,130 tickets.
